  • Recently I built a double LEGO Botanical Garden Modular building, the model was fantastic, but the exterior was pretty crowded. Today I decided to redesign the model so that it would be better integrated into the LEGO City. I did this by giving it an additional 16 studs of space which allowed me to add detailed pathways and more flowers.
